Output e26ceb7f3e89cfe8ddfa3405fd2c9875dd020dcbf678f68e36bccb9e1702a169:15

value
33359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c0b4c4a81ad54c22527981d1e649bee7ec04faf OP_EQUAL
address
3ETW4Q8eCmwHWKsLSb6GX3yEQKqexREGMu
transaction
e26ceb7f3e89cfe8ddfa3405fd2c9875dd020dcbf678f68e36bccb9e1702a169
spent
true